When i came out of sea and sat on a beach, i noticed blood on my leg (the sea is stoned and the beach too). could this be because of the stones? or could needle be in the sea and do it? can i get infection?

Little or no risk: Obviously no distant forum adviser can know the source of the blood. If there is blood, there has to be an obvious wound which you would feel and be able to see. If not, perhaps it wasn't blood at all. There is little or no infection risk from a wound from beach stones. An unknown needle wound is extraordinarily unlikely. Keep the wound clean and cover it (e.g. band aid). Otherwise no worries.
